Cursive Upden 2 is a regular weight, narrow, high contrast, italic, short x-height font.

A slanted, brush-pen script with pronounced thick–thin modulation and tapered terminals. Strokes show a fluid, continuous rhythm with frequent entry/exit swashes and looping joins, giving words a cohesive handwritten flow. Letterforms are narrow with compact counters and a quick baseline movement that creates a slightly bouncy texture; ascenders are tall and prominent while lowercase bodies stay relatively small. Capitals are more gestural than formal, with open curves and occasional extended lead-ins that add emphasis without becoming overly ornate.

This style suits logos and wordmarks for lifestyle brands, café or boutique packaging, and short headlines where a handwritten voice is desired. It performs well in invitations, greeting cards, and pull quotes, and it can add personality to social posts or hero text. For best results, use at display sizes or with generous spacing so the contrast and narrow forms remain clear.

The font reads as personable and energetic, like quick, confident handwriting done with a flexible pen. Its high-contrast strokes and sweeping curves lend a lightly romantic, boutique feel, while the informal construction keeps it approachable and conversational. Overall it suggests spontaneity and warmth rather than strict refinement.

The design appears intended to mimic fast, stylish brush handwriting with a contemporary, fashion-adjacent tone. It prioritizes expressive rhythm, sweeping capitals, and lively thick–thin contrast to create immediate personality in short text. The overall aim is a readable yet distinctly handwritten script for display-centric communication.

Connectivity varies naturally across letters, so the script alternates between smoothly linked runs and small breaks that enhance a hand-drawn impression. Numerals follow the same brush-contrast logic, with simple, readable shapes and occasional curved starts/finishes that match the lettering. The texture is driven by sharp tapers and rounded turns, producing a crisp, ink-like finish in display sizes.
